    6 Ways to Save Money on Campsite Rentals

    Camping is such a fun way

    to enjoy the outdoors with family and friends. If you have camped before, you know that a campsite costs so much less than a hotel room rental, making it a budget friendly way to travel. And even though camping is already budget friendly, you should know there are ways to save even more on your next campout! Look below at 6 ways to save money on campsite rentals, so you can sleep under the stars for less.

    1. Book multiple campsite rentals nights.

    Just about all campsites will over a discount if you book more than one night. Discounts will vary, but always be sure to ask about a multi night discount. You are already taking the time to set up camp and get cozy, you might as well stay for awhile!

    Should you find yourself staying for an extended period, such as 2 weeks or more, you may be even more inclined to receive a discount. Some parks will even offer discounts to residents who volunteer service hours at the park during their stay. It is worth asking if this option is available.

    2. Avoid holiday weekends.

    Campgrounds tend to fill up to the brim on holiday weekends. If you are flexible in your planning, skip those holiday weekends and save some cash. Not only will costs most likely be higher, but you may have to pay a higher deposit and book a minimum number of nights. Memorial Day, Independence Day, and Labor Day are the most popular and typically most expensive weekends.

    3. Share a site.

    Some campgrounds will allow multiple tents or small campers on each site. If you have friends camping with you, see if you can share a site. You might only have one water/electric hook up in this case, but if that is a non issue then sharing a site is ideal. Be sure to ask prior to booking if this is allowed and how many campers you can have per site. The rules tend to vary so you want to be sure you stay in line with the regulations of the park.

    4. Only rent what you need.

    Campsites offer so many options when it comes to campsites. Some of electric, some have water, some have both! Electric amps, size, and other amenities will all vary. When choosing a site, only pay for what you actually need. The simpler you keep it, the less your spot will be. There is no point in paying for a camping spot that offers amenities you won’t even use.

    5. Head out during the off season!

    Early spring and late fall will typically offer cheaper camping rates. Parks are less full at this time and so deals are in abundance. If you can handle the cooler weather, it may be ideal to go camping during these months so you can save some extra cash. Parks will also be less crowded, which means prime camping sites for you to choose from!

    6. Ask about those campsite rentals discounts.

    Are you a resident in the state you are camping in? Are you a AAA member? A senior? Did you serve in the military? Most parks offer discounts for at least one or even all of the circumstances above. Before you book, ask about any applicable discounts you might qualify for. This way, you can save anywhere from 10%-20% off your stay! Follow your favorite campgrounds on social media, so you can be sure to see any specials or current discounts they are offering.

    As you can see, there are very simple ways to camp for less. Consider these 6 ways to save money on campsite rentals and see how budget friendly camping can truly be.
